Lot Description

A Jade Pendant the celadon leaf shaped stone incised to the front with two characters, the back with inscriptions reading qingqan shi shang liu ("the clear spring flows upon the stone") from a poem written by a Tang Dynasty poet, Wang Wei. Length 1 3/4 inches.
